What's Happening?
An underground robot fight club has emerged in a San Francisco basement, attracting enthusiasts and participants interested in robotics and competitive engineering. The club provides a platform for individuals
to showcase their robotic creations in combat scenarios, fostering innovation and creativity within the robotics community. The events are held discreetly, emphasizing the underground nature of the club and its appeal to those seeking unconventional entertainment.
